Bill Gates Lists $59M Yacht 'Wayfinder' Featuring Pickleball Court

Bill Gates has listed 'Wayfinder,' his support vessel for the hydrogen-powered superyacht, for $59 million, ending his sea-faring dreams for good. This impressive vessel features a helipad that doubles as a pickleball court, a medical room, a fold-out gym, and a garage filled with water toys, offering luxury and sport combined on the high seas.

Built by Astilleros Armon in 2021, Wayfinder spans 224 feet and serves as both a support vessel and a capable exploration yacht. The vessel includes a large open aft deck that transforms between a helipad and a pickleball court, emphasizing Gates' passion for the sport. Additionally, Wayfinder boasts a heli-lounge, a fully-equipped medical facility, and storage for three tenders up to 12 meters and three smaller tenders, alongside a fold-out beach club and a top-notch gym.

Listed by Edmiston, Wayfinder’s market entry coincides with the sale of Project 821, reportedly before Gates took delivery. The vessel’s interior combines elegant whites with teak-colored furniture and vibrant pillows.
